Intro
We have had some unwanted guests at our house.
If you’re thinking its you, its not...
It’s cold outside, so these guests are coming in for a little warmth without our permission.
On the outside the look kinda cute… but these are not the kind of guests you want.
Mice.
We could hear something at night, saw evidence, now we had to do something.
Now that I could see where they were going, We have a plan.
We buy traps, set them along the path we know they are on, and destroy them!!
I think we are winning the battle.
I told my wife, I want them to go back and let there communities know of the destruction.
Generations will tell the stories and a great fear will keep them from invading our house again.
Imagine life is a journey.
There is a destination set for us all by our creator and God.
there is a path we are on from here to there.
Along this path of life we are on, imagine someone has gone in front of us and put out traps, pitfalls and landmines.
All with the intent of our destruction.
We being the journey, happy and excited and then we hit a couple.
Now we no longer enjoy the journey, we are just afraid of what will happen next.
Afraid to go forward.
We began this series last week by uncovering the idea that there is an unseen realm.
There is a God, there is good, there is light.
There is also a Devil, and evil and darkness.
This is a good representation of life and Satan’s strategy.
He’s setting traps in your life to detour and derail you from the path that God has for you.
The devil is the enemy of anything good, anything Godly.
Anything God creates and plans Satan wants to destroy.
Most of all us.
We are susceptible to attack and defeat when we are oblivious of the tactic.
When we don’t see it coming.
1 Peter 5:8 (NIV)
Be alert and of sober mind.
Your enemy the devil prowls around like a roaring lion looking for someone to devour.
He is waiting.
You need to know that if you are living for God, and especially if you are set on making a difference for Gods kingdom, that satan is out for you.
No one is immune.
You don’t have to be surprised when there is an attack.
There is a target on your back.
The traps are set.
But is gets a lot less intimidating, scary and overwhelming when we know what he is up to.
A road with landmines is really scary, unless you know exactly where they are and what to watch out for.
The bible gives us a pretty clear picture of the tactics that the enemy uses against us so we don’t live blind.
SATAN LOSES HIS POWER WHEN I CAN SEE HIS PLAN
5 Strategies that Satan has used from the very beginning that we have to live very aware of.
If I can see it, know it then I can be prepared for it.
1. DECEIT
John 8:44 (ESV)
You are of your father the devil, and your will is to do your father’s desires.
He was a murderer from the beginning, and does not stand in the truth, because there is no truth in him.
When he lies, he speaks out of his own character, for he is a liar and the father of lies.
Revelation 12:9 (ESV)
And the great dragon was thrown down, that ancient serpent, who is called the devil and Satan, the deceiver of the whole world—he was thrown down to the earth, and his angels were thrown down with him.
Satan is a liar and deceiver by nature.
Genesis 3:1–4 (ESV)
Now the serpent was more crafty than any other beast of the field that the Lord God had made.
He said to the woman, “Did God actually say, ‘You shall not eat of any tree in the garden’?”
And the woman said to the serpent, “We may eat of the fruit of the trees in the garden, but God said, ‘You shall not eat of the fruit of the tree that is in the midst of the garden, neither shall you touch it, lest you die.’ ” But the serpent said to the woman, “You will not surely die.
With Deceit he attacks your mind.
If he can get you believe a lot of things that aren’t true, he can get you to walk away from what is right.
So he creeps lies about God, and life and others into your mind.
God isn’t good.
God isn’t real.
He isn’t loving.
God can’t provide for you.
He can’t save you.
That person is the worst, they are talking about you.
Far too many of us have believed things that simply aren’t true.
This leads to a life of fear, anxiety, worry, paranoia, controlling.
I believe that this is one of the greatest battles we will face in life, that of our mind.
But if we know it’s coming, we can prepare for it.
If we know that lies are coming in, we better know what is true and right.
The protection for lies is truth.
Satan speaks lies, God speaks truth.
Romans 12:2 (NIV)
Do not conform to the pattern of this world, but be transformed by the renewing of your mind.
Then you will be able to test and approve what God’s will is—his good, pleasing and perfect will.
(True that is a filter)
Don’t assume just because you think it, its true.
where are you getting your source of truth?
lives will head in the direction of my thought life.
Subject your thoughts to God’s word and Godly counsel. is it right?
2. DISCOURAGEMENT
Satan will use discouragement to defeat you.
Discouragement is simply a deficit of courage.
With Discouragement he attacks our hearts.
We just lose the will and desire to go forward.
I just don’t think I can anymore.
Discouragement leads to doubt, disengagement and depression.
Revelation 12:10 (NIV)
Then I heard a loud voice in heaven say: “Now have come the salvation and the power and the kingdom of our God,
and the authority of his Messiah.
For the accuser of our brothers and sisters, who accuses them before our God day and night,
has been hurled down.
The Accuser.
Satan is constantly accusing you, hurling self defeating thoughts at you.
Satan always lies about God, but sometimes he tells the truth about us.
And that’s what is so hard.
Oh come on you know what you did, how could you do anything for God.
Who do you think you are.
You could never do that.
